The teytoySensory Buckle Pillow Toys are designed for toddlers aged 1-3, featuring 12 basic skills and 6 different latches to enhance fine motor development and cognitive skills. Made from durable polyester, this travel-friendly toy offers engaging activities that promote problem-solving and hand-eye coordination, making it perfect for both everyday play and special needs therapy.

The buckles were great; the strings not so much.
My granddaughter (18 months) LOVES buckles, and can be entertained for 20 minutes with just the buckle on her stroller. I thought that this would be the answer to car rides or some other independent play.We got this when she was in year old, and while we did like the buckles, the shoestring running through the numbers was another story. After about 5minutes with the product, it got tangled and had to be removed. On or off though, that string is a potential safety hazard for little ones that do not yet have the hand/eye coordination to use it.Overall, we like the product. The different buckles offer various levels of difficulty, becoming easier as one gets older. That being said, I would (and did) get a “pillow” that is simplier for kids under 18 months.
